Sheinbaum Ensures Security
- Mexican authorities will deploy nearly 100,000 security personnel for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.
- President Claudia Sheinbaum announced the plan after Nemesio "El Mencho" Oseguera's death sparked reprisals in Jalisco and other states.
- The deployment includes 20,000 military members, 55,000 police, and private security, aided by drones and bomb-sniffing dogs.
- Officials say safety is guaranteed for the June 11–July 19, 2026 tournament in Mexico City, Guadalajara, and Monterrey.
